Algeria: Trial of Karim Tabbou, a Hirak figure, begins
The trial of Karim Tabbou, a key figure in the Hirak anti-government protest movement, opened on Monday, after several postponements. The chairman of the small, unregistered opposition party the Democratic Social Union (UDS), appeared free before the Kolea court. He is accused of undermining the morale of the army.
